20090126863 | Device, installation and method for aligning and/or assembling filtering elements - A device for aligning and/or assembling filtering elements, in particular of particulate filter, an installation for assembling a filter from filtering elements incorporating the device, and a method for aligning and/or assembling monolithic filtering elements, in particular for making a particulate filter. The device includes a back plate whereon are set the filtering elements, the back plate being for example fixed on a base plate, and walls laterally foldable upwards by a folding mechanism, such that the filtering elements are mutually maintained tightly when the walls are in an upper position. | 05-21-2009 |
20090288758 | METHOD OF PRODUCING HONEYCOMB SEGMENT BONDED ARTICLE - There is provided a method for producing a honeycomb segment bonded article, the method inhibiting decrease in strength properties due to a variance in a texture of the bonding material layer between a plurality of honeycomb segments unitarily bonded together by means of the bonding material layer formed of the bonding material. After producing a preliminary block by unitarily bonding a plurality of honeycomb segments having a plurality of cells being partitioned by partition walls and passing through in the axial direction with a bonding material at a bonding face of each of the honeycomb segments and drying the honeycomb segments, the preliminary blocks are integrally bonded together, or honeycomb segments of one layer are bonded on an outer peripheral face of the preliminary block. | 11-26-2009 |
20100154982 | CORROSION RESISTANT HONEYCOMB - Corrosion resistant metallic honeycomb composed of a plurality of honeycomb cells having cell walls that include cell edges that form the edge of the honeycomb. A corrosion resistant coating that contains polyamideimide is used to cover the cell walls and cell edges. The corrosion resistant coating is preferably applied after the honeycomb structure has been formed. | 06-24-2010 |

20120205035 | Method of Making Multilayer Product Having Honeycomb Core - A process of making a multilayered product having an interior honeycomb layer or core. The interior layer is formed by passing a generally flat web of material between rollers to create a corrugated web. The corrugated web is cut and folded to create the honeycomb core. Outer protective skins are applied to exterior surfaces of the interior layer to create a multilayered material which is then cut to size. | 08-16-2012 |

20130146216 | Cell Matrix System And Method For Manufacturing Same - A cell matrix expandable structure includes of a plurality of interconnected cells normally in flat form but readily expandable into the form of a container upon the introduction of fluid. The structures may be made out of recyclable films. Methods of manufacturing the cell matrix in a continuous manufacturing process are also disclosed. | 06-13-2013 |

20150075704 | METHOD FOR MANUFACTURING HONEYCOMB STRUCTURE - A method for manufacturing a honeycomb structure includes: preparing a base material sheet; forming a plurality of strips by forming a plurality of slits parallel to each other at regular intervals in the base material sheet; twisting each of the strips around an axis along which the strip extends; temporarily forming a plurality of cell areas defined by the strips by temporarily, partially bonding each of the twisted strips to another strip adjacent thereto; and completing the form of the cell areas by performing permanent bonding on the temporarily bonded portions by inserting a mold into the temporarily formed cell areas and heating the strips. | 03-19-2015 |
